Try an energetic hike at the nearby Paris Landing State Park located just five minutes away. Hikers of all ability levels can tackle three trails ranging from easy to moderate, including Healthy Hike Trail, a paved, accessible one-mile stroll. Families can download the offline trail map and use their GPS to pinpoint their exact location in the woods. 

Take mom out on a kayak or canoe and explore our area’s scenic wooded banks and water ways. Canoe and kayak rentals are available at Paris Landing State Park swim beach or local vendors. Access points in Land Between the Lakes (LBL) are available online here and are a wonderful, lazy way to enjoy the great outdoors with mom. Have a boat? Need to rent one? Check with us.

Knowledgeable rangers at the TN National Wildlife Refuge can help the whole family experience the joys of birding. Bird watching is enjoyed throughout local parks, but the Tennessee National Wildlife Refuge Visitor Center, only twenty minutes away, offers a birding checklist and map of the refuge, trails and overlook. Look for osprey nesting and keep an eye to the sky for eagle nests and great blue herons.  

Another Mother’s Day activity fun for everyone -fishing! Try wetting your line at LBL, only fifteen miles from Swan Bay. Reel in local bass, sauger, catfish, and bluegill, then make use of the Paris Landing State Park Marina’s fish-cleaning station.
